Understanding the Environmental Footprint of Cryptomining
Cryptocurrency mining, particularly proof-of-work (PoW) algorithms like Bitcoin, has long faced criticism for its significant energy consumption. According to the Cambridge Centre for Alternative Finance, Bitcoin’s annual energy usage has exceeded that of entire countries such as Argentina or the Netherlands, raising alarm over sustainability and climate change implications.
However, recent innovations suggest pathways toward greener practices. These include integrating renewable energy sources, optimizing hardware efficiency, and developing hybrid consensus mechanisms. Industry leaders acknowledge that sustainable practices are not just ethical imperatives but strategic advantages in attracting environmentally conscious investors and customers.
Harnessing Data and Technology to Foster Sustainable Mining Practices
Advanced data analytics play a pivotal role in identifying cost-effective and eco-friendly locations for mining operations. Through sophisticated modeling, companies analyze grid power mix, cooling solutions, and infrastructure costs to optimize their energy footprint.
| Parameter | Impact on Sustainability |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Renewable Energy Integration | Reduces carbon emissions; improves reputation | Hydropower in Iceland |
| Hardware Efficiency | Decreases energy per hash; extends hardware lifespan | ASIC miners with energy optimization |
| Location Optimization | Lower cooling and transmission costs; leverages local energy sources | Texas oil and solar farms |
Such data-driven insights are transforming the industry, enabling miners to develop operations that are both economically viable and environmentally responsible.
Innovations in Mining Infrastructure and Resource Management
Real-world case studies highlight successful applications of these principles. For instance, some operators have established data centers alongside renewable energy plants, utilizing surplus power during low-demand periods. Incorporating cooling technologies such as immersion cooling further reduces energy waste, elevating overall efficiency.

Emerging Trends and Industry Insights
Looking forward, several promising developments are shaping the sustainable mining landscape:
- Heat Recovery Systems: Utilizing waste heat for local heating applications, reducing overall energy demand.
- Decentralized Mining Pools: Distributing operations to utilize renewable resources locally and democratize participation.
- Regulatory Frameworks: Governments increasingly incentivize green practices through tax credits and renewable energy subsidies.
Moreover, increasing stakeholder awareness is leading to greater investments in sustainable infrastructure. Financial institutions are scrutinizing environmental, social, and governance (ESG) metrics, pushing firms toward greener solutions.
